About us

La Grotte des Fromages is a Saint Leonard institution that offers its patrons beautifully crafted sandwiches, assorted cheeses, italian specialty dishes such as fresh pastas, porchetta, meatballs, veal and chicken cutlets, “trippa” and an assortment of fish. These can be enjoyed in-house, on our sunny terrace, or as a quick take-out option. La Grotte also boasts many imported Italian products that can be purchased in their market, most notably their exclusive line of sicilian olive oil, Olio Sarullo.

La Grotte has been voted amongst the best “panino” and best porchetta from Panoram Magazine readers for 2018.

Our Specialties

Fresh pastas, porchetta, meatballs, veal and chicken cutlets, “trippa”, an assortment of fish and a menu that changes daily.

Review Summary

La Grotte des Fromages is described by reviewers as a place with delicious dishes and memorable flavors, where the menu shines with standout sandwiches and well prepared meat options. The food gets frequent praise for the quality of the meats, veal chop, steaks, and fish, with cannolis and paninis named among the highlights, and many note the dishes to be flavorful and satisfying. Service is often described as friendly and attentive, and the atmosphere is a pleasant balance of energy and comfort, though it can get a bit loud with larger groups. A few comments mention price and occasional inconsistency with some sandwiches, but many visitors appreciate the option to bring your own wine and feel the overall experience is worth the trip. Overall, La Grotte des Fromages emerges as a reliable pick for confident flavors, strong entrees, and a lively dining vibe that draws both locals and visitors.
